        13 months of owning a DC14 has convinced me that I&apos;ve received my money&apos;s worth and then some.
First, the suction is amazing - especially the attachment suction. It does not weaken or quit, no matter how full the collection canister becomes.
Second, switching between attachment and floor suction is a no-brainer - upright handle for attachment, reclined handle for floor.
Third, I haven&apos;t had to buy a single bag, filter, or belt for this vacuum. The collection canister is large, clear, and easy to empty (the bottom drops open at the push of a button, so I stick the bottom into a plastic bag -very little mess!). The filter and case are washable (I am considering purchasing a second set so I can clean the filter and keep vacuuming). The belt is lifetime, which makes my husband happy!
Fourth, the hose storage is very compact. I hated struggling with a hose as well as a vacuum, especially when carrying the vacuum up or down stairs.

        I was tired of throwing out vacuums every 3 years.  I was immediately impressed with the quality and ingenuity of the design, as well as the strength and durability of the materials.  While the design is not intuitive, once you figure out how things fit together, their very easy to do.  This model has a better and easier way to use the extension wand/hose than the earlier model (DC 07).  The lack of a &quot;low reach&quot; attachment on this package is a notable oversight.
